My Muse

A day of beauty -rainbows on the sky;
the oceans’ and the mountains’ majesties;
bold colors when day’s light begins to die -
my muse delights in wonders such as these.

Emotions – mostly happy ones – not sad;
imaginings that make my spirit dance;
a time recalled because I felt so glad;
nostalgia of a beautiful romance.

A story that is begging to be told
poetically! I feel the need to try
to put down words and also turn to gold
most precious moments that have made me sigh.

I rarely write from sorrow or from strife.
My muse is most enthused by love of life!
